🏢 Hbada Brand Overview: Who Are They?

Founded in 2010, Hbada Group pioneered adjustable-angle technology in computer chairs. By 2011, the company entered independent R&D, specializing in ergonomic technology. Today, Hbada is a global brand with products sold across the United States, Europe, Japan, Singapore, and beyond.

Key brand facts:

  • Founded: 2010
  • Headquarters: China (global operations)
  • Specialty: Ergonomic office chairs, gaming chairs, standing desks
  • Certifications: SGS and BIFMA certified
  • Market position: Top-selling ergonomic chair brand on major e‑commerce platforms
  • Industry influence: Led the development of China’s “Ergonomic Chair” group standard

What Hbada is known for:

  • Bio-Synchronized design philosophy: Chairs that adapt to your body’s natural movements
  • Innovative lumbar support: Three-zone elastic lumbar systems and AI lumbar tracking
  • Premium features at mid-range prices: 4D headrests, 6D armrests, retractable footrests
  • Big & tall friendly: Many models support users from 5’1″ to 6’5″

1. Hbada P2 Air — Best Entry-Level Ergonomic Chair

The Hbada P2 Air is the brand’s most accessible ergonomic chair, designed for home offices, smaller desks, and hybrid work setups. Priced around $229, it offers strong airflow and a compact footprint without sacrificing essential ergonomic features.

Key Specs & Features:
  • Lumbar support: 3D adjustable — height, depth, and width
  • Headrest: 2D adjustable (height + angle)
  • Armrests: 3D adjustable
  • Mesh: Premium high-resilience mesh with responsive bounce
  • Seat: Breathable mesh material — strong, wear-resistant, and comfortable
  • Height range: Supports users from 5’4″ to 6’2″
Pros:
  • ✅ Excellent breathability — ideal for warm offices
  • ✅ Compact footprint — fits smaller desk setups
  • ✅ Good value for money at the entry-level price point
  • ✅ Easy assembly
Cons:
  • ❌ Limited seat depth — may not suit larger users
  • ❌ Rating: 3.8/5 from 62 reviews — some users find it less premium than higher-end models

Verdict: The P2 Air is a solid entry-level choice for budget-conscious buyers who prioritize breathability and a compact design. It’s a practical pick for everyday productivity.

2. Hbada E3 Air — Best for Big & Tall Users

The Hbada E3 Air is designed specifically for bigger-framed users who need a wider seat, stronger weight capacity, and breathable mesh. Priced around $349, it’s a solid value choice for heavier users.

Key Specs & Features:
  • Weight capacity: Marketed as Big & Tall with reinforced construction
  • Seat: Wider padded seat with breathable mesh back
  • Adjustments: Height, recline, tilt lock, armrest adjustments
  • Mesh: Fully breathable mesh design for a cool sitting experience
  • Seat depth: 1.97 inches of adjustable seating depth
  • Height range: Supports users from 4’11” to 6’5″
  • T-Shape Support System: Targets neck, waist, and shoulders
Pros:
  • ✅ Designed specifically for larger-framed users
  • ✅ Excellent breathability with high-quality mesh
  • ✅ Reinforced nylon base and stronger gas lift
  • ✅ Rating: 4.2/5 from 560 reviews
Cons:
  • ❌ Priced higher than entry-level competitors
  • ❌ May not offer the same premium feel as the E3 Pro

Verdict: The E3 Air is the go-to Hbada chair for big and tall users who need extra width, weight capacity, and breathability without the premium price tag of luxury brands.

3. Hbada E3 Pro 2026 — Best Overall Value / Premium Mechanical

The Hbada E3 Pro 2026 Edition is the brand’s flagship mechanical ergonomic chair. Priced around $509, it delivers premium features at a fraction of the cost of high-end competitors. It’s built upon 16 years of R&D and has been praised by tech sites like Android Police and Notebookcheck.

Key Specs & Features:
  • Lumbar support: Patented 3-Zone Elastic Lumbar Support System covering L1-L5 — features 40° floating wings that wrap around paraspinal muscles
  • Headrest: 4D dual-axis headrest supporting C3-C7 cervical vertebrae
  • Armrests: 6D adjustable (720° omni-mechanical rotation)
  • Recline: 140° deep recline with footrest for “active recovery” sessions
  • Auto Gravity-Sensing Chassis: Automatically calibrates recline resistance based on user weight
  • Mesh: CloudMesh™ with 16.5% airflow boost
  • Height range: Supports users from 5’1″ to 6’5″
  • Certifications: SGS Class 4 gas lift — 120,000 safety tests
Pros:
  • ✅ Exceptional lumbar support — “the most comfortable lower back support”
  • ✅ Premium features at a mid-range price
  • ✅ 6D armrests with 720° rotation — ideal for tablet and mobile users
  • ✅ 140° recline + retractable footrest
  • ✅ “One of the best ergonomic office chairs I’ve tried” — T3 review
  • ✅ Rating: 4.0/5 from 3,362 reviews
Cons:
  • ❌ Some “strange adjustments” — headrest could be more comfortable
  • ❌ Heavy to assemble — large office chair
  • ❌ Price may be high for budget-conscious buyers

Verdict: The E3 Pro 2026 is Hbada’s sweet spot. It delivers professional-grade ergonomics — 3-zone lumbar, 4D headrest, 6D armrests — at a price that undercuts premium competitors. If you want premium features without the AI premium, this is the chair to buy.

4. Hbada X7 Smart — Best AI-Powered / Tech-Forward

The Hbada X7 Smart Ergonomic Chair is the world’s first AI lumbar-tracking ergonomic chair. Priced at $1,234–$1,499, it competes with premium chairs from Steelcase and Herman Miller. It features a solid aluminum frame, segmented back supports, and a remote control for AI functions.

Key Specs & Features:
  • AI Lumbar Tracking: Smart chip monitors movement and preferences in real-time — senses your position and continuously supports the lower back
  • Massage & Heat: Lumbar support includes massage and heat functions
  • Fan cooling: Built-in fan in the seat
  • Headrest: 4D dual-axis
  • Armrests: 720° adjustable
  • Construction: Solid aluminum frame + mesh coverings
Pros:
  • ✅ Solid construction and myriad adjustability
  • ✅ Smart lumbar support that moves with you
  • ✅ Massage and heat functions in the lumbar support
  • ✅ Competing with premium chairs from Steelcase and Herman Miller
Cons:
  • ❌ Armrests move too easily with the slightest knock
  • ❌ Issues charging via magnetic cable
  • ❌ Seat design makes sitting cross-legged uncomfortable
  • ❌ Concerning three-year warranty for such a complex product
  • ❌ Premium price — $1,200+

Verdict: The X7 is an ambitious, tech-heavy powerhouse designed for those who spend most hours at their desks and are willing to pay a premium to minimize fatigue. If you want AI-powered adjustability, massage, and heat, the X7 delivers. But if you’re looking for the best value, the E3 Pro offers similar mechanical quality without the AI premium.

✅ General Pros & Cons of Hbada Chairs

✅ Hbada Pros

  • Excellent value for money: Premium features at mid-range prices
  • Innovative lumbar support: Three-zone and AI-powered systems
  • Highly adjustable: 4D headrests, 6D armrests across the lineup
  • Breathable mesh: CloudMesh™ with superior airflow
  • Big & tall friendly: Supports users up to 6’5″
  • Retractable footrest: Available on E3 Pro and other models
  • SGS and BIFMA certified: Safety and quality assurance

❌ Hbada Cons

  • Seat cushion firmness: Some users find the seat too firm for 10+ hour sessions
  • Weight limit concerns: Users over 200 lbs may experience “bottoming out”
  • Mixed durability reports: Some users report squeaking after a few months
  • Armrest stability: Some models have armrests that move too easily
  • Assembly: Premium models are heavy and may require two people
  • Warranty: X7 has a concerning three-year warranty for a premium product

❓ Frequently Asked Questions: Hbada Ergonomic Chairs

🪑 Is Hbada a good brand?
Yes. Hbada has been a top-selling ergonomic chair brand on major e‑commerce platforms since 2019. The brand holds SGS and BIFMA certifications and has led the development of industry standards. However, like any brand, quality varies across models — premium models like the E3 Pro and X7 offer significantly better build quality than entry-level options.
💺 Which Hbada chair is best for back pain?
The Hbada E3 Pro 2026 is the best choice for back pain relief. Its patented 3-zone elastic lumbar support system covers the L1-L5 area and features 40° floating wings that wrap around paraspinal muscles. Users consistently praise it as having the “most comfortable lower back support”. If you want AI-powered adjustability, the X7 offers smart lumbar tracking.
📏 Are Hbada chairs good for tall people?
Yes. The E3 Pro and E3 Air support users from 5’1″ to 6’5″. The E3 Air, in particular, is designed specifically for big and tall users with a wider seat and reinforced construction. The P2 Air supports users from 5’4″ to 6’2″.
💰 Is Hbada cheaper than Herman Miller?
Yes. Hbada chairs are significantly more affordable. The E3 Pro is around $509, while the premium X7 is $1,234–$1,499. By comparison, the Herman Miller Embody starts at over $1,600. Hbada offers similar premium features at a fraction of the price.
🛠️ Are Hbada chairs easy to assemble?
Most users find assembly straightforward with clear, illustrated instructions. The E3 Pro is heavy to put together and may require two people. The P2 Air is praised for easy setup. Hbada also provides video guides on their website.
